#e6564c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e6564c is composed of 90.2% red, 33.7%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.6% magenta, 67%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 3.9 degrees, a saturation of 75.5% and a lightness of 60%. #e6564c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ffac98 with #cd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#e6564c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e6564c has RGB values of R:230, G:86,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.67,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15095372.

Shades and Tints of #e6564c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0201 is the darkest color, while #fef9f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e6564c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9f9393 is the less saturated color, while #fe4234 is the most saturated one.
